I suspect you accidentally tried to measure volts with the switch in the mA position and blew the fuse. No disrespect intended, I say this because that is exactly what I did right out of the box so had to order some fuses off Amazon to replace it. I knew better but just got too excited to start playing with my new Pokit Pro. I am used to my Fluke beeping at me if I have the probes in the wrong position when switching to voltage measurement.

You said it: your Fluke multimeter beeps when you have probes in the wrong position AND you switch measurement.
PokIt app warns you to move the switch if you try to change the measurement from the "Mode" panel, but nobody, PokIt or Fluke, will ever warn you if you try to measure a voltage and your don't even change the mode from Amperometer.
That's how I probably blew my 500 mA fuse as well: yesterday I measured some current and this morning i just turned on my PokIt Pro and tried to measure a voltage without changing mode nor moving the switch.
Tip no. 4: after using the PokIt Pro, ALWAYS slide the switch to Volts; this way the probes will use the high impedance circuitry and you won't run the risk of breaking fuses because you forget to switch the mode ;)

Levering them up is not enough, you need to actually PULL them out sliding out of the casing. Is you notice there’s some space with a ramp that guides the fuse up and out of its socket.
Problem is it’s tightly fit into its place and there is no space to grab the fuse tip with your fingers and pull it out. You need to use a pair of small-tip pliers to grab it.0
